NPR Tosses One of Their Own Under the Bus

NPR has terminated its contract with Juan Williams, one of its senior news analysts, after he made comments about Muslims on the Fox News Channel.
NPR said in a statement that it gave Mr. Williams notice of his termination on Wednesday night.

Juan writes opinionated columns for the Washington Post, New York Times and The Wall Street Journal AND is a Fox News Contributor.
The move came after Bill O’Reilly asked him to respond to Bills opinion that the United States was facing a “Muslim dilemma.” Mr. O’Reilly said,“The cold truth is that in the world today jihad, aided and abetted by some Muslim nations, is the biggest threat on the planet.”
